与所有的关系型数据库一样,Mysql仿佛是一头让人难以琢磨的怪兽。它会随时停摆,让应用限于停滞,或者让你的业务处于危险之中。 事实上,许多最常见的错误都隐藏在MySQL性能问题的背后。为了确保你的MySQL服务器能够一直处于全速运行的状态,提供持续稳定的性能,杜绝这些错误是非常重要的。然而,这些错误 ...
分类:
数据库 时间:
2018-03-21 15:37:09
阅读次数:
181
一、MySQL的主要适用场景 1、Web网站系统 2、日志记录系统 3、数据仓库系统 4、嵌入式系统 二、MySQL架构图: 三、MySQL存储引擎概述 1)MyISAM存储引擎 MyISAM存储引擎的表在数据库中,每一个表都被存放为三个以表名命名的物理文件。首先肯定会有任何存储引擎都不可缺少的存放 ...
分类:
数据库 时间:
2018-03-10 16:05:56
阅读次数:
211
一 服务器参数调优,有哪些关键点? 1. 应用访问优化 优化方法 | 性能提升效果 | 优化成本 | 说明 | | | 减少数据访问能不访问就不访问 减少磁盘IO | 1~1000 | 低 | 缓存服务器缓存mysql数据,Redis、memorycache 返回更少的数据较少网络传输和磁盘IO | ...
分类:
数据库 时间:
2018-03-02 01:20:27
阅读次数:
349
[client]port = 3306socket = /tmp/mysql.sock[mysqld]port = 3306socket = /tmp/mysql.sockbasedir = /usr/local/mysqldatadir = /data/mysqlpid-file = /data/mysql/mysql.piduser = mysqlbind-address = 0.0.0.0s
分类:
数据库 时间:
2018-02-28 11:17:12
阅读次数:
132
本文转载自ITPUB公众号 配置文件中具体修改的内容是什么呢?要是面试官问你,你该怎么回答?你想下,你坐在一间屋子里。 服务器的 MySQL性能优化,有两个大致的方向考虑,第一个是服务器硬件,另一个是MySQL自身的my.cnf配置文件。 服务器的磁盘,CPU和内存,这些都是要考虑的因素 1,磁盘的 ...
分类:
数据库 时间:
2018-02-23 13:23:27
阅读次数:
179
iredmine的linux服务器mysql性能优化方法与问题排查方案 问题定位: 客户端工具: 1. 浏览器inspect-tool的network timing工具分析 2. 浏览器查看 response header, 分析http server 与 web server. 服务器工具: 0. ...
分类:
数据库 时间:
2018-02-12 20:11:59
阅读次数:
423
1.1 Mysql数据库的优化技术 1、mysql优化是一个综合性的技术,主要包括 1. 表的设计合理化(符合3NF) 2. 添加适当索引(index) [四种: 普通索引、主键索引、唯一索引unique、全文索引] 3. 分表技术(水平分割、垂直分割) 4. 读写[写: update/delete ...
分类:
数据库 时间:
2018-02-04 11:19:47
阅读次数:
151
一 概念介绍 Index Condition Pushdown (ICP)是MySQL 5.6 版本中的新特性,是一种在存储引擎层使用索引过滤数据的一种优化方式。a 当关闭ICP时,index 仅仅是data access 的一种访问方式,存储引擎通过索引回表获取的数据会传递到MySQL Serve ...
分类:
数据库 时间:
2018-01-28 15:36:24
阅读次数:
184
转:https://www.cnblogs.com/luxiaoxun/p/4694144.html MySQL性能优化总结 一、MySQL的主要适用场景 1、Web网站系统 2、日志记录系统 3、数据仓库系统 4、嵌入式系统 二、MySQL架构图: 三、MySQL存储引擎概述 1)MyISAM存储 ...
分类:
数据库 时间:
2018-01-23 20:32:41
阅读次数:
181
mysql性能优化 如何发现有问题的SQL? 使用MySQL慢差日志对有效率问题的SQL进行监控 下面就是与慢查询相关的sql语句: show variables like 'show_query_log' //用这个看一下是否开启了慢查日志 show variables like '%log%'; ...
分类:
数据库 时间:
2018-01-03 17:36:01
阅读次数:
195